$\frac{\sqrt[3]{8}}{\sqrt{16}} \div \sqrt{\frac{100}{49}} \times \sqrt[3]{125}$ is equal to :
1
7
2
$\frac{7}{4}$
3
$\frac{4}{7}$
4
$\frac{1}{7}$
